Structure of the IELTS Test
Both versions of the test evaluate the exact same four skills, however the Reading and Writing sections differ in material and context. The Listening and Speaking sections equal for both Academic and General Training.

Note: The overall test time for Listening, Reading, and Writing is 2 hours and 45 minutes, finished in one sitting. The Speaking test may be set up on the very same day or approximately a week before or after the other tests.
Comprehending the IELTS Scoring System
IELTS ratings are reported on a 9-band scale, developed to be familiar and transparent to organizations worldwide. Prospects receive private ratings for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king, which are then averaged and rounded to the nearby half-band to produce the Overall Band Score.

2. Can I retake simply one section of the IELTS if I do not get the score I need?
Yes, thanks to the intro of IELTS One Skill Retake, candidates who have taken the computer-delivered test can retake a single area (Listening, Reading, Writing, or Speaking) if they didn't achieve their target score the first time. This conserves time and money compared to retaking the entire test.
3. How long is my IELTS rating valid?
IELTS test outcomes are usually legitimate for two years from the test date. This is since language proficiency can significantly alter with time.
4. Just how much does the IELTS expense?
The cost of the IELTS varies depending upon the nation and test center area, generally ranging from ₤ 215 to ₤ 260 GBP. Prospects need to examine the official British Council, IDP, or local test center websites for precise rates in their region.
